Signs Your Vent Needs Cleaning

Signs Your Dryer Vent Needs Cleaning in Dunmore, PA

Clothes Taking More Than One Cycle to Dry in Dunmore

The most common and clearest symptom of a clogged dryer vent is clothes that used to dry in one cycle now requiring two in Dunmore, PA. The dryer needs adequate airflow through the vent to exhaust the heat and moisture it extracts from the clothes in Dunmore. A restricted vent reduces that airflow and the clothes remain damp at the end of the cycle in Dunmore, PA.

Dryer Running Excessively Hot to the Touch in Dunmore, PA

A dryer that is hot to the touch on the exterior surfaces during operation has restricted airflow preventing heat from exhausting through the vent in Dunmore. The heat that is supposed to be exhausted with the moisture is instead building up inside the dryer cabinet in Dunmore, PA. This elevated temperature is both a component wear accelerant and the temperature environment in which lint ignition risk increases in Dunmore.

Burning Smell During Dryer Operation in Dunmore

A burning smell during dryer operation is a specific warning sign that should be treated as urgent in Dunmore, PA. Lint that has accumulated at a hot point in the vent system can produce a burning smell before igniting in Dunmore. If you notice a burning smell during dryer operation, stop the dryer immediately and call MBM for same-day dryer vent cleaning in Dunmore, PA. Do not resume using the dryer until the vent has been cleaned and inspected in Dunmore.

Laundry Room Feels Humid or Stuffy After Drying in Dunmore, PA

A laundry room that feels noticeably humid or stuffy after a drying cycle has a dryer vent that is not exhausting effectively to the exterior in Dunmore. The moisture the dryer is extracting from the clothes is not being exhausted outside in Dunmore, PA. Elevated indoor humidity from a restricted dryer vent can contribute to mold growth in the laundry area in Dunmore.

More Than One Year Since the Last Cleaning in Dunmore

The general recommendation for dryer vent cleaning is annually for most households in Dunmore, PA. Households with more frequent laundry usage, multiple household members, or pets may benefit from cleaning every six months in Dunmore. If it has been more than a year since the last professional cleaning, the service is due regardless of whether obvious symptoms are present in Dunmore, PA.

Visible Lint Around the Exterior Vent Opening in Dunmore, PA

Visible lint accumulation around the exterior vent cap opening indicates the vent system is sufficiently restricted that lint is backing up to the exit point in Dunmore. A correctly functioning dryer vent exhausts air and moisture to the exterior without leaving lint deposits around the vent opening in Dunmore, PA.

Why Lint Is Highly Flammable in Dunmore

Lint is composed of fine fibers from clothing fabrics in Dunmore, PA. These fine fibers have an extremely high surface area relative to their mass, which makes them highly combustible in Dunmore. A small quantity of lint exposed to an ignition source ignites quickly and burns intensely in Dunmore, PA. Lint accumulation in a dryer vent that reaches an ignition temperature from the dryer's heat output creates exactly the conditions for a rapidly developing fire in Dunmore.

Why the Risk Increases With Every Load on an Uncleaned Vent in Dunmore, PA

Lint accumulates with every load in Dunmore. The restriction increases with every load in Dunmore, PA. The operating temperature of the dryer increases as the restriction increases in Dunmore. And the gap between the operating temperature and the ignition temperature of the accumulated lint narrows with every load on an uncleaned vent in Dunmore, PA. The risk is not static. It increases progressively with every load in Dunmore.

The most common cause of extended drying times is a restricted dryer vent that cannot exhaust heat and moisture efficiently in Dunmore. The dryer is extracting moisture from the clothes but cannot remove it from the drum fast enough because the vent is restricting the exhaust airflow in Dunmore, PA. Professional vent cleaning that restores correct airflow typically restores single-cycle drying in Dunmore.
Rigid metal duct is the ideal dryer vent material because it provides maximum airflow with minimum lint accumulation in Dunmore. Semi-rigid metal duct is acceptable for the transition section behind the dryer where some flexibility is needed in Dunmore, PA. Foil accordion duct is not acceptable for dryer venting because it collapses easily, traps lint at its ridges, and is a fire hazard in Dunmore. Plastic duct is not acceptable for any dryer vent application in Dunmore, PA.

A dryer vent that exhausts into a wall cavity, attic, or crawl space rather than to the exterior is a serious safety and moisture problem in Dunmore. The moisture and lint exhausted from the dryer accumulates in the enclosed space, creating conditions for mold growth and elevated fire risk in Dunmore, PA. All dryer vents must exhaust directly to the exterior of the home in Dunmore.
A standard dryer vent cleaning for a typical residential installation takes 30 to 60 minutes in Dunmore. Longer or more complex vent runs with multiple bends take longer in Dunmore, PA.
Yes. Restoring correct airflow through the dryer vent allows the dryer to exhaust heat and moisture efficiently in Dunmore. The dryer reaches the correct drum temperature faster. Clothes dry in a single cycle. And the dryer motor and heating element do not work as hard per load in Dunmore, PA.
The maximum recommended dryer vent length for most residential installations is 25 feet of equivalent length for rigid metal duct in Dunmore. Each 90-degree bend reduces the effective maximum length by approximately 5 feet. Each 45-degree bend reduces it by approximately 2.5 feet in Dunmore, PA. Longer runs may require a dryer vent booster fan to maintain adequate exhaust airflow in Dunmore.
